SUN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2024 in Review

273 of the 6,924 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Sunoco (SUN) for Q2 2024, worth a combined $3.3B — up 161% from $1.26B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 85 funds opened new SUN positions and 18 closed out — a net gain of 67 holders — while 110 added to existing stakes and 34 trimmed.

The largest buyer was ALPS Advisors, adding an estimated $498M. The largest seller was Jennison Associates, exiting entirely with an estimated $12.2M sold.
